STEPS on How to put together a computer

1-Prepare the Case

 
2- Prepare the Motherboard
 
3 -Install the CPU
 
4 -Install the Memory
 
5 -Install the Motherboard
 
6 -Install the Floppy Drive
 
7- Prepare and Install the
            Hard Drive and CD-ROM
 

8 -Install the Video Card,
            Sound Card and Modem

 
9 -Boot Up
 
10 -Apply the Finishing Touches :)
 

 

I have done alot of research on what conponents needed to build a computer and where the best places to find each one are.I found each of the following conponents from one of the websites I listed below .To make it easier I even provided a link to send you right to the source if anyone is interested.Right next to the conponents are my sources for the parts which I previously informed you about , and the parts prices which I found from each of the sites aswell .

Computer Case: COOLER MASTER Elite 330 RC-330-KKN1-GP Black SECC ATX mid Tower:www.newegg.com/ $39.99

 

Motherboard: Biostar T-Series TA690G AM2 690G Socket AM2 1000MHz DDR2-800 M-ATX 1000FSB, ATA/133, 4DDR2 DIMM, 1 PCI Express x16, 1 PCI Express x1, 2 PCI, USB 2.0, Audio, Gigabit LAN, RAID/SATA, VGA D-Sub, DVI, HDMI :www.zipzoomfly.com/ $75.98 

 

CPU: AMD Athlon 64 FX-62 CPU Bundle Ultra X3 1000-Watt ATX SATA/SLI power supply, AMD Athlon 64 FX-62 2.80GHz Socket AM2 OEM Processor:www.tigerdirect.com/$299.99

 

Memory: Corsair TWIN2X2048-5400C4 2GB DDR2-675 XMS2-5400 Xtreme Performance: www.zipzoomfly.com/$78.50

 

 Hard drive: Seagate/Barracuda 7200.10 / 500GB / 7200 / 16MB / Serial ATA-300 / OEM:www.tigerdirect.com/$119.99

 

 Modem: Zoom 5590 X6 ADSL with 802.11G Ethernet:www.cdw.com/$92.99

 

Video card: XFX GeForce 7300 GT / 512MB DDR2 / SLI Ready / PCI Express / DVI / VGA / HDTV: www.tigerdirect.com/$79.99

 

Sound Card: Creative Sound Blaster X-Fi Xtreme Audio:www.cdw.com/$51.99

 

 Cooling System: KOOLANCE EX2-750BK Liquid:www.newegg.com/$249.99

 

 Power Supply: Antec NeoHE 500 High Efficiency 500W:www.zipzoomfly.com/$89.00

 

 CD/DVD: PIONEER DVR-212DBK 18X SATA DVD Burner Black DVD±RW Bulk:www.zipzoomfly.com/$39.99

 

 Floppy drive: SAMSUNG Black 1.44MB 3.5 Model SFD321B/LBL1 – OEM:www.newegg.com/$6.99

 

Network Card: TRENDnet TEG-PCITXR 10/ 100/ 1000/ 2000Mbps PCI Copper Gigabit 1 x RJ45:www.newegg.com/$15.99

 

 Monitor: SAMSUNG 226BW Black 22" 2 ms (GTG) DVI Widescreen LCD 300 cd/m2 700:1(DC 3000:1):www.newegg.com/$319.99

 

 Keyboard/Mouse: Labtec Media Wireless Desktop:www.cdw.com/$26.51

 

 Operating System: Windows Vista Home Premium 64-bit DSP OEM DVD:www.tigerdirect.com/$119.99

 

 Application Software: Microsoft Office Pro 2007 – Upgrade:www.tigerdirect.com/$289.99

 

UPS: CyberPower Intelligent LCD Series CP1500AVRLCD 1500VA 900W 4 x 5-15R Battery/Surge Protected 4 x 5-15R Surge Protected Outlets:www.newegg.com/$169.99

 

 Speakers: Cyber Acoustics CA 2014 - PC multimedia -4 watt:www.cdw.com/$15.56
